  3. Windows 10 keeps asking for browser confirmation

    Hi Ian,

    Thank you for the reply.

    Sorry for the delayed reply.

    I suggest you to try the steps provided below and check if it helps.


    • Go to Start > Settings > System.

    • Choose Default apps, then scroll down to Web browser.

    • Tap or click the browser that’s currently listed as your default, then choose the browser from the list of apps.
    If the issue persists, then try to change it the other way.

    • Go to Search and enter Default programs, and then tap or click
      Default Programs (You will see two options, click on one with the green circle with a check mark).

    • Tap or click Set your default programs.

    • Select Internet Explorer from the list of programs.

    • Tap or click Set this program as default, and then tap or click
      OK.

    If the issue persists, then try SFC scan and check.

    Scan for damaged system files. Right-click the Start icon and select
    Command Prompt (Admin). In the Command Prompt window, type
    sfc /scannow and hit Enter.

    Then type dism /online /cleanup-image /restorehealth and hit Enter.

    Hope this helps in resolving the issue. If the issue persists, do get back to us. We will be happy to assist you.

    Windows 10 apps ask for login when you are already logged in to Windows

    Hi,

    To resolve your concern about Windows 10 apps which is asking you to login, we suggest that you turn off the UAC on your computer. Please follow these steps:

    • Go to Start.
    • Select Control Panel.
    • In the search box, type UAC, and then click Change User Account Control setting.
    • To turn off UAC, move the slider to the Never notify position, and then click
      OK.
    • Administrator permission required If you're prompted for an administrator password or confirmation, type the password or provide confirmation.
    • You will need to restart your computer for UAC to be turned off.

    Let us know how it goes.
